Trace level must be 12 to show binds. You can also use dbms_support (install via $ORACLE_HOME/rdbms/admin/dbmssupp.sql): Dbms_support.start_trace_in_session(<sid>,<serial>, waits=>true, binds=>true) Or dbms_monitor.session_trace_enable (same parameters) in 10g.
